Christmas Thoughts - 2007


You hear “White Christmas” everywhere
It is an old favorite and a familiar tune
When you hear it, you know Christmas will be here soon
You can tell also by the crispness in the air
Now to go home, and wrap the presents there

As I climb into my warm bed
Visions of packages fill my head
I think I bought a present for everyone
So for now the shopping is done
Making my list, I listened to what they said

I wonder if they’ll like the presents I got
I wonder if they will like them a little or a lot
It is too late now the presents are all wrapped
And my funds are completely tapped
I truly hope they like what I bought

I wonder too, what I’ll get
I hope no one will forget
Like all the other boys
I really like nifty toys
Particular those that make some noise

I like my presents wrapped with care
Opening them myself, I prefer not to share
I don’t suppose I am unusual in that way
It is something we all think but hardly ever say
Mostly I am looking to be with my family that day
